New Product Development (NPD) is the total process that takes a service or a product from conception to market. New or rebranded products and services are meant to fill a consumer demand or an opportunity in the marketplace. Feb 8, 2023 · Commercialization is defined as the process of making a product or service available for sale. Commercialization entails production, marketing, and distribution. Commercialization generally starts with the development of a new product or service. Development efforts may be undertaken by an individual, a team, or a company. Developing a new drug and bringing it to market is cost-, time-, and risk-intensive. According to studies, it’s estimated that launching a new drug can take a decade and cost between $314 million to $2.8 billion in R&D costs.
